Transaction 44bc70f2e509ccdba23c94b86ab0422c41be48f9d94eebbf084efcba67e8477d

1 Input
2 Outputs
  • 44bc70f2e509ccdba23c94b86ab0422c41be48f9d94eebbf084efcba67e8477d:0
  • value  714635404494
    address  12X6w11rrAX4CBpc7eqSfkMiTXyFheUwng
  • 44bc70f2e509ccdba23c94b86ab0422c41be48f9d94eebbf084efcba67e8477d:1
  • value  2570892
    address  19haN35fsUKGTnQqqL7XcuGBeSpenmuhzr